Question reference: S6W-25468

  • Asked by: Jackson Carlaw, MSP for Eastwood, Scottish Conservative and Unionist Party
  • Date lodged: 14 February 2024
  • Current status: Answered by Jenni Minto on 11 March 2024

Question

To ask the Scottish Government whether the entirety of the £1 million mesh fund was needed to deliver the one-off, £1,000 financial support awards to mesh survivors, and if this is not the case, whether it will set out how much of the allocated budget was required to make payments to all successful applicants.


Answer

£648,000.

At the time of its announcement we indicated that the Mesh Fund would have an upper ceiling of £1 million, we have therefore ensured that the remainder of those funds have been invested in other mesh-related initiatives, including the Reimbursement Scheme, in line with calls made in the mesh campaigners’ Charter.
